Minutes

On Monday, February 3, 2025 at 5:00 p.m., the City of Wauchula Commission met for its regular scheduled workshop. Nadaskay called the workshop to order. Commissioners present were Anne Miller, Mayor Pro-Tem Russell Smith, Mayor Keith Nadaskay, Sherri Albritton, and Gary Smith. Also present were City Manager Olivia Minshew, Assistant City Manager Sandee Braxton, Assistant Chief of Police Tom Fort, Community Development Director Kyle Long, Community Redevelopment Agency Director Jessica Newman, Director of Project Management and Procurement Ward Grimes, City Attorney Kristie Hatcher-Bolin, Code Enforcement Officer Raina Bergens, and City Clerk Stephanie Camacho. Nadaskay gave the virtual meeting statement. Code Enforcement Updates Bergens provided an overview of opened and closed code enforcement cases from 10/1/24-1/31/25, including property liens filed. Food Truck Park Discussion Long explained that, because the discussion regarding a potential food truck park in the downtown area was brought before the Commission at a previous meeting, Marisa Barmby with Central Florida Regional Planning Council researched this topic and prepared a presentation with a variety of ideas for consideration. Barmby presented the options to the Commission. There was much discussion on this topic. Ordinance 2025-01 Hearing Procedures Regarding Dangerous Dogs Fort presented the ordinance to adopt hearing procedures consistent with Florida Statutes pertaining to dangerous dog classifications. Fort explained there were incidents involving a resident’s dog that presented a need to create the procedures. Ordinance 2025-02 Solid Waste Rate Changes Braxton presented the ordinance with rate modifications based on the direction previously given by the Commission. Braxton explained this ordinance included the City’s 5-year rate schedule to ensure equitable pricing among all solid waste customer classes. Resolution 2025-02 FDOT Maintenance Agreement Minshew presented the resolution to renew the existing agreement with FDOT for the City to continue maintaining the right of way on US Highway 17 between Will Duke Road and KD Revell Road, and on Main Street from US Highway 17 to Griffin Road. Quarterly Financial Report Braxton presented the report to the Commission. CITY ATTORNEY REPORT No report. CITY MANAGER REPORT Report given. CITY COMMISSIONER REPORTS No report. Nadaskay closed the Commission workshop and opened the CRA workshop. Krause Services Extension Request Newman presented the request for the Board to consider extending the contract for lawncare services, per the terms of the agreement. CRA RFQ 25-01 Professional Engineering Services Newman presented the bid documents to the Board. CRA RFQ 25-02 Professional Planning Services Newman presented the bid documents to the Board. With no further business to discuss, Nadaskay adjourned the workshop at 6:41 p.m. Richard K. Nadaskay, Jr., Mayor Stephanie Camacho, City Clerk
